CVE-2025-10318
JeecgBoot WebSocket Message sendWebSocketMsg improper authorization
Description
A vulnerability was identified in JeecgBoot up to 3.8.2. Affected by this vulnerability is an unknown functionality of the file /api/system/sendWebSocketMsg of the component WebSocket Message Handler. The manipulation of the argument userIds leads to improper authorization. The attack can be initiated remotely. The exploit is publicly available and might be used. The vendor was contacted early about this disclosure but did not respond in any way.

Solution
- Update JeecgBoot to version 3.8.3 or later.
- Apply vendor patches or security updates promptly.
- Restrict access to the WebSocket Message Handler API.
- Monitor network traffic for suspicious WebSocket activity.
